Surface area Prep work



Before repainting your home, make certain to extensively prepare the surfaces by cleaning and fixing any kind of imperfections. Begin by washing the walls with a mild detergent remedy to remove dust, dirt, and oil. Make use of a sponge or fabric to scrub gently, ensuring all surface areas are tidy and dry before continuing.

Examine the wall surfaces for any type of cracks, holes, or peeling off paint. Fill out any kind of voids with spackling substance, sanding it smooth once completely dry. For bigger holes, take into consideration making use of a patch package for a seamless coating.

Next, meticulously evaluate the trim, baseboards, and crown molding. Wipe them down with a moist cloth to get rid of any type of gunk or deposit. Check for any type of dents or scratches that require to be filled and sanded.

Do not ignore the ceilings-- clean them thoroughly and deal with any type of blemishes before painting.

Color and End Up Selection



To attain the preferred aesthetic for your home, meticulously select the shades and finishes that will enhance the general look of each area. When choosing colors, take into consideration the state of mind you want to develop in each area. Lighter tones can make an area really feel more sizable and ventilated, while darker tones can include heat and coziness. Consider the natural light that gets in the room and how it might influence the shade throughout the day.



Along with color, the finish of the paint is also essential. Matte finishes can conceal blemishes but might be more challenging to cleanse, while satin and semi-gloss surfaces are more resilient and cleanable. Glossy surfaces can add a touch of elegance however may highlight problems in the wall surfaces.

Bear in mind that various spaces may take advantage of different color design and finishes based upon their function and the atmosphere you want to produce.

Furniture and Décor Security



Take into consideration covering your furniture and decoration things to protect them from paint splatters and trickles throughout the professional paint process. Use plastic ground cloth or old bedsheets to shield your items from accidental spills.

Move furnishings to the center of the room or into an additional area far from the walls being repainted. If relocating huge things isn't feasible, group them with each other and cover with protective products.

For smaller decor pieces, remove them from the space completely if feasible. If removing them isn't a choice, very carefully wrap them in plastic or towel to prevent paint damages.

Pay special attention to electronics and useful items that could be quickly messed up by paint.

Do not forget about your flooring. Put down protective coverings like rosin paper or fabric drop cloths to secure carpets, wood floorings, or ceramic tiles from paint splatters. Secure the coverings in place with painter's tape to avoid any type of accidents while the painting is in development.

Taking these safety measures will aid make certain that your furnishings, decoration, and floors remain in leading condition during the professional painting procedure.
